Mark Michael Moroz Sells 6,100 Shares of Live Oak Bancshares (NYSE:LOB) Stock

Live Oak Bancshares, Inc. (NYSE:LOBGet Free Report) insider Mark Michael Moroz sold 6,100 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, July 28th. The shares were sold at an average price of $42.08, for a total value of $256,688.00. Following the sale, the insider owned 12,110 shares in the company, valued at approximately $509,588.80. The trade was a 33.50%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through the SEC website.

Live Oak Bancshares Price Performance

NYSE LOB opened at $42.41 on Friday. The stock has a market capitalization of $1.96 billion, a P/E ratio of 14.93 and a beta of 1.88. The business has a 50 day simple moving average of $39.96 and a 200 day simple moving average of $37.89. Live Oak Bancshares, Inc. has a one year low of $29.36 and a one year high of $43.85.

Live Oak Bancshares (NYSE:LOBG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 22nd. The company reported $0.74 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.64 by $0.10. The firm had revenue of $156.15 million for the quarter. Live Oak Bancshares had a return on equity of 11.95% and a net margin of 12.68%. Equities analysts expect that Live Oak Bancshares, Inc. will post 3.07 earnings per share for the current year.

Live Oak Bancshares Announces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, June 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, June 2nd were paid a $0.03 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Tuesday, June 2nd. This represents a $0.12 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.3%. Live Oak Bancshares’s payout ratio is currently 4.23%.

Live Oak Bancshares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Live Oak Bancshares, Inc is a bank holding company headquartered in Wilmington, North Carolina, and operates through its subsidiary Live Oak Banking Company. Founded in 2008, the company leverages a branchless, technology-driven platform to deliver specialty lending and deposit products across the United States. Live Oak Bancshares completed its initial public offering in February 2018 and trades on the NYSE under the ticker symbol LOB.

The company’s primary focus is on originating and servicing commercial loans for small businesses in select industry verticals.
